In the Creel Harrison Gallery at the Gertrude Herbert Institute of Art from August 1 – October 23, 2024, view “Fix Yourself A Plate.” This collection of recent works by artist Heather René Dunaway explores mother-daughter relationships, body image, southern food culture, and the healing of generational trauma through mixed media works that utilize found and nostalgic materials, such as fabric from her Grandmother’s crafts collection, hand-written notes, and old family photos alongside paintings and photography.
